From Original Authorized King James Version phpBible_av
Lamentations 3:26 It is good that a man should both hope and quietly wait for the salvation of the LORD.

From Original Young's Literal Translation Version YLT
Lamentations 3:26 Good! when one doth stay and stand still For the salvation of Jehovah.

From Original World English Bible Translation Version WEB
Lamentations 3:26 It is good that a man should hope and quietly wait for the salvation of Yahweh.

Strong's Dictionary Number: [2342]

2342

1 Original Word: חוּל
2 Word Origin: a primitive root
3 Transliterated Word: chuwl
4 TDNT/TWOT Entry: TWOT - 623
5 Phonetic Spelling: khool
6 Part of Speech: Verb
7 Strong's Definition: or chiyl {kheel}; a primitive root; properly, to twist or whirl (in a circular or spiral manner), i.e. (specifically) to dance, to writhe in pain (especially of parturition) or fear; figuratively, to wait, to pervert:--bear, (make to) bring forth, (make to) calve, dance, drive away, fall grievously (with pain), fear, form, great, grieve, (be) grievous, hope, look, make, be in pain, be much (sore) pained, rest, shake, shapen, (be) sorrow(-ful), stay, tarry, travail (with pain), tremble, trust, wait carefully (patiently), be wounded.
8 Definition:
  1. to twist, whirl, dance, writhe, fear, tremble, travail, be in anguish, be pained
    1. (Qal)
      1. to dance
      2. to twist, writhe
      3. to whirl, whirl about
    2. (Polel)
      1. to dance
      2. to writhe (in travail with), bear, bring forth
      3. to wait anxiously
    3. (Pulal)
      1. to be made to writhe, be made to bear
      2. to be brought forth
    4. (Hophal) to be born
    5. (Hithpolel)
      1. whirling (participle)
      2. writhing, suffering torture (participle)
      3. to wait longingly
    6. (Hithpalpel) to be distressed

9 English:
0 Usage: bear, (make to) bring forth, (make to) calve, dance, drive away, fall grievously (with pain), fear, form, great, grieve, (be) grievous, hope, look, make, be in pain, be much (sore) pained, rest, shake, shapen, (be) sorrow(-ful), stay, tarry, travail (with pain), tremble, trust, wait carefully (patiently), be wounded
